5 stars Like hearing it for the first time
When Natalie Merchant announced her departure from 10,000 Maniacs, there was much speculation about whether or not she would be able to match the quality of the Maniacs songs in a solo career. On my first listen through the Tigerlily CD in the summer of 1995, I knew for sure that Natalie had come through. Tigerlily was an amazing album. 3 stars Not enough
There was more musical invention and a little more lyrical range with the Maniacs, I think. There are lovely moments in this CD, but it feels like she ran out of really good ideas--and energy--before the CD was filled up. She sounds like a talented but dispirited person rousing herself to do good things and then sinking back into lassitude or depression.
